Autism Early Intervention / 自闭症早期干预
Definition
Autism early intervention is the source’s evidence-oriented support frame for helping autistic or possibly autistic children build communication, social attention, daily participation, and family interaction without treating autism as an error to erase.
Current Synthesis
The episode places early intervention between two mistakes: passive waiting and cure fantasy. Xu Yue says signs such as language delay, weak eye contact, unusual play, repetitive movement, sensory overload, and limited social gestures should prompt attention, and she names early childhood as an especially valuable intervention window. At the same time, the episode rejects the idea that intervention should mean risky repair, miracle pills, or making the person non-autistic.
The practical center is family-involved and behavioral: parents need to put down distractions, sit with the child, play, take turns, use face-to-face interaction, and follow professional guidance. Adults can also benefit from social-skill support, so the concept is early-weighted but not age-exclusive.
Key Claims
- Early attention is useful when children show language delay, weak social gaze, unusual play, repetitive behavior, sensory overload, or missing gestures.
- The source names roughly one-and-a-half to five or six years old as a valuable intervention period, while saying intervention at other ages can still help.
- Evidence-based intervention in the episode includes behavioral approaches, pivotal response training, joint-attention training, and applied-behavior-analysis-related methods.
- Family participation is not optional: progress depends on repeated everyday interaction, not only clinic sessions.
- Intervention should expand communication and participation while staying aligned with Autism As Human Difference.

Counterevidence & Qualifications
This is a source-scoped public-education synthesis, not a clinical guideline. The episode does not settle which intervention model fits which child, how to evaluate provider quality, or how to handle controversies around specific behavior-analysis practices.
